Part 2 of my episode with Lily and Marcus is here! We talk in depth about their dental hygiene school experiences and navigating parenthood, as well as employment during their programs. Both originally graduated with their associate’s in dental hygiene and explain the steps they took to get into a master’s program. Don’t miss their final words of wisdom to all dental hygienists at the end of the episode!
